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Station Facilities and Services

Charing Cross station provides a range of facilities designed to make your journey as smooth and accessible as possible. For starters, the ticket office is open every day of the week, and ticket machines are available round the clock, allowing for seamless ticket purchases and collections. The station ensures accessibility with step-free access throughout and wheelchair assistance. You can find accessible toilets and induction loops installed at various points for those who are hearing impaired.

Waiting times at Charing Cross are comfortable with partially or fully covered canopies stretching across platforms, though there is no dedicated first-class lounge or seating area. For dining and retail therapy, the main concourse offers refreshment facilities, shops, and ATM machines, although a currency exchange service isn’t available on-site.

Transport Connections

Reaching your next destination from London Charing Cross is a breeze, thanks to the numerous transport links available. A 24-hour taxi rank is located just outside the station's main entrance. Things get even more convenient with buses operating on The Strand. For those preferring to navigate the city below ground, both the Bakerloo and Northern lines are accessible from Charing Cross.

Station Facilities and Ticketing Options

The station features a variety of amenities designed to make your commute as comfortable and convenient as possible. Open from 06:30 to 10:00 on weekdays, the ticket office is there to assist with your travel needs. If you're in a hurry, or outside of these hours, ticket machines are available for purchasing or collecting tickets bought online. These machines are tailored for accessibility and support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.

For those utilizing smartcards, both issuance and validation facilities are available at the station, ensuring swift and seamless travel. The station also incorporates induction loops for those requiring audio assistance. While facilities like luggage storage and refreshment options are currently not available, the station prioritizes security with CCTV consistently monitoring the premises.

Accessibility and Assistance

Drayton Park station, classified as a Category C station, unfortunately lacks step-free access. The assistance meeting point is strategically located by the ticket office to assist travelers as needed. Staff are present on weekdays until 10:00 to help with your arrival and departure. For those requiring further travel support, help points are conveniently placed on platforms, and a free helpline is available to arrange for any required assistance.

While there are no waiting rooms, seating is provided for your comfort as you await your train. Unfortunately, the station does not feature accessible toilets or parking accommodations, which may pose challenges for some travelers. Cycling enthusiasts will find stands to secure their bicycles, safeguarded by station CCTV.
